Looks like they've put quite a bit of effort into re-engineering the suspension for saab utilization. The car looks like it handles well, it seems to take the corners without much body roll. I have read that the V6 XWD version of the car weighs in at 4500lbs, while the 4 cyl fwd is a 1000lbs lighter than its predecessor at about 3400. 1100lb difference between trim models is ridiculous.
